Какие меры безопасности нужно принимать при работе с программным обеспечением


В наше время все больше и больше людей зависят от программного обеспечения в своей повседневной жизни. Будь то приложения для мобильных устройств, веб-приложения или компьютерные программы, без них нам становится трудно справиться с самыми простыми задачами. Однако, с ростом использования программного обеспечения, возрастает и угроза безопасности.

Киберпреступники постоянно разрабатывают новые методы атаки, чтобы получить доступ к нашим личным данным и использовать их в своих целях. Поэтому, необходимо обеспечить безопасность при работе с программным обеспечением, чтобы защитить себя и свои данные.

Одним из основных способов обеспечения безопасности является установка и регулярное обновление антивирусных программ на всех устройствах, используемых в работе с программным обеспечением. Антивирусные программы помогут обнаружить и блокировать вредоносное ПО, которое может быть установлено на ваш компьютер или мобильное устройство через программы, загрузки из Интернета или электронные письма.

Кроме использования антивирусных программ, необходимо также быть осторожным при загрузке и установке программного обеспечения. Установка программ только с официальных и проверенных источников и чтение и проверка лицензионного соглашения перед установкой – важные меры, которые помогут избежать установки вредоносного ПО на ваше устройство.

Важность обеспечения безопасности программного обеспечения

Обеспечение безопасности программного обеспечения играет фундаментальную роль в защите частных личных данных и важных информационных ресурсов. Небезопасное программное обеспечение может привести к серьезным последствиям, таким как утечка конфиденциальной информации, взлом системы, хищение личных данных, а также повреждение жизненно важных систем, такие как энергетические сети или системы здравоохранения.

Одной из основных причин взлома программного обеспечения является отсутствие должной защиты и обновлений. Вредоносные программы и вирусы постоянно развиваются, поэтому важно обеспечить актуальность и безопасность программного обеспечения через регулярные обновления и патчи. Кроме того, важно использовать современные антивирусы и межсетевые экраны для превентивной защиты от вредоносных атак.

Помимо этого, безопасность программного обеспечения также зависит от процесса разработки и контроля качества. Неправильное использование языков программирования, отсутствие проверки на уязвимости и слабые механизмы авторизации и аутентификации могут стать причиной критических уязвимостей в программном обеспечении.

Все эти факторы подчеркивают важность обеспечения безопасности программного обеспечения на всех его этапах: от разработки до эксплуатации и обновления. Только тщательное контролирование и применение современных технологий безопасности могут гарантировать надежную защиту программного обеспечения и личных данных.

Потенциальные уязвимости и риски

Одной из основных уязвимостей является недостаток контроля доступа. Когда приложение не достаточно строго проверяет права доступа пользователя к определенным ресурсам или функционалу, злоумышленник может использовать эту слабость для получения привилегий, которыми он не должен обладать. Недостаточный контроль доступа может быть связан, например, с ошибками в аутентификации и авторизации.

Внедрение вредоносного кода — это еще одна серьезная уязвимость, которая позволяет злоумышленнику внедрить и исполнить свой вредоносный код на компьютере пользователя или на удаленном сервере. Такие атаки могут привести к краже конфиденциальной информации, удалению или изменению файлов, а также к контролю над системой.

Существует целый ряд других уязвимостей и рисков, таких как SQL-инъекции, межсайтовый скриптинг (XSS), подделка идентификаторов (CSRF), отказ в обслуживании (DoS) и другие. Каждая уязвимость имеет свои особенности и требует различных методов защиты.

Чтобы предотвратить потенциальные риски в работе с программным обеспечением, необходимо уделять внимание тестированию на безопасность, регулярно обновлять программное обеспечение, использовать надежные методы шифрования, применять принципы безопасной разработки и обеспечивать надлежащий контроль доступа. Также важно осознавать, что безопасность — это процесс, и постоянный мониторинг и обновление безопасных мер уже необходимыми для справления с новыми угрозами и уязвимостями, которые могут появляться.

Как выбрать надежное программное обеспечение

Вот несколько практических советов, которые помогут вам выбрать надежное программное обеспечение:

  1. Проверьте репутацию разработчика. Исследуйте их историю, ознакомьтесь с отзывами пользователей и изучите их предыдущие работы. Это позволит вам оценить надежность и качество программного обеспечения.
  2. Убедитесь в наличии поддержки и обновлений. Следите за тем, чтобы разработчик регулярно работал над улучшением программного обеспечения, выпускал обновления и решал проблемы безопасности. Это гарантирует, что ваше программное обеспечение будет актуальным и защищенным от новых угроз.
  3. Проверьте наличие сертификаций и стандартов безопасности. Некоторые программы проходят специальную сертификацию, которая подтверждает их соответствие нормам безопасности. Это может быть важным критерием при выборе программного обеспечения.
  4. Изучите политику конфиденциальности и обработки данных. Важно убедиться, что разработчик программного обеспечения обеспечивает безопасность ваших данных и соблюдает нормы конфиденциальности.
  5. Обратите внимание на открытый исходный код. Программное обеспечение с открытым исходным кодом предоставляет возможность самостоятельно изучить код и убедиться в его надежности и отсутствии скрытых уязвимостей.
  6. Сравните функциональность. При выборе программного обеспечения также важно сравнить его функциональность с вашими потребностями. Убедитесь, что выбранное решение соответствует вашим требованиям и задачам.

Учитывая эти советы, вы сможете принять информированное решение при выборе надежного программного обеспечения, которое обеспечит безопасность вашей работы.

Актуальные методы защиты данных

Одним из актуальных методов защиты данных является шифрование. Шифрование позволяет передавать данные по незащищенным каналам связи, при этом обеспечивая их конфиденциальность. Существуют различные алгоритмы шифрования, которые обеспечивают высокий уровень безопасности данных.

Еще одним методом защиты данных является аутентификация. Аутентификация позволяет проверить подлинность пользователя или системы перед предоставлением доступа к данным. Для аутентификации могут использоваться пароли, ключи, биометрические данные и другие методы.

Кроме того, для защиты данных используются методы контроля доступа. Методы контроля доступа определяют, кто может получить доступ к данным и какие права доступа ему предоставить. Это позволяет минимизировать риски несанкционированного доступа и утечки данных.

Дополнительным методом защиты данных является резервное копирование. Резервное копирование позволяет создать копию данных, чтобы в случае их потери или повреждения можно было восстановить информацию. Регулярное создание резервных копий является важным шагом для обеспечения безопасности данных.

МетодОписание
ШифрованиеПроцесс преобразования данных в нечитаемый вид для обеспечения конфиденциальности.
АутентификацияПроверка подлинности пользователя или системы перед предоставлением доступа к данным.
Контроль доступаОпределение, кто может получить доступ к данным и какие права доступа предоставить.
Резервное копированиеСоздание копии данных для возможности их восстановления в случае потери или повреждения.

Добавить комментарий

Вам также может понравиться